From: Trevor Woerner @ 2012-09-05 17:13 UTC (permalink / raw)
  To: ml; +Cc: yocto@yoctoproject.org

I also found that I had to add:

    BB_DANGLINGAPPENDS_WARNONLY = "yes"

at the end of my conf/local.conf since I received a:

    ERROR: No recipes available for:
      /home/trevor/devel/yocto/raspi/poky/meta-raspberrypi/recipes-multimedia/libav/libav_0.7.4.bbappend

the first time I tried baking (even when using the exact commits for
both poky and meta-raspberrypi as specified in the instructions).
Maybe it's just me?

On 5 September 2012 18:13, Trevor Woerner <twoerner@gmail.com> wrote:
> I also found that I had to add:
>
>     BB_DANGLINGAPPENDS_WARNONLY = "yes"
>
> at the end of my conf/local.conf since I received a:
>
>     ERROR: No recipes available for:
>       /home/trevor/devel/yocto/raspi/poky/meta-raspberrypi/recipes-multimedia/libav/libav_0.7.4.bbappend
>
> the first time I tried baking (even when using the exact commits for
> both poky and meta-raspberrypi as specified in the instructions).
> Maybe it's just me?

Not at all.  Guacamayo uses the meta-raspberrypi layer and does this:

# meta-raspberrypi has libav.bbappend, for which we do not have the base recipe
# meta-ti has a bunch of recipes with broken license
BBMASK=".*/meta-raspberrypi/recipes-multimedia/libav/|.*/meta-ti/recipes-misc"
